Compare all specifications:
1959 Austin-Healey 3000 | 2007 Ford E-150 | |
Make | Austin-Healey | Ford |
Model | 3000 | E-150 |
Year Released | 1959 | 2007 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2911 cc | 4605 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 124 HP | 226 HP |
Engine RPM | 4600 RPM | 4800 RPM |
Torque | 237 Nm | 388 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3000 RPM | 3500 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 83.4 mm | 90 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 88.9 mm | 90 mm |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 8 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4010 mm | 5390 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1540 mm | 2020 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1250 mm | 2060 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2340 mm | 3510 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 54 L | 132 L |
